What is Bluerails?

Bluerails preview

Bluerails is a discovery and payments infrastructure platform built for the agentic economy — a world where AI agents autonomously browse, evaluate, and transact on behalf of users. Most websites today are built exclusively for human visitors; Bluerails bridges that gap by making businesses readable and payable by AI agents. The platform covers four layers: agent identity verification, site readability (via llms.txt, schema markup, and HTTP 402 endpoints), checkout execution, and global settlement via stablecoin rails with multi-currency payout support.


Key Features

  • Agent Identity Verification

    Identifies and authenticates inbound AI agents in real time, verifying who sent them, their authorization scope, and spending mandates before any interaction is served.

  • Agent Readability Layer

    Automatically generates llms.txt files, schema markup, and structured signals that make your site legible to AI agents — not just human browsers.

  • Checkout Execution

    Defines and enforces what agents are permitted to do on your site, enabling autonomous booking, content access, or purchases within your set boundaries.

  • Global Settlement Rails

    Handles full payment settlement via stablecoin infrastructure with support for EUR payouts, SEPA, and international corridors — sub-cent transactions included.

  • Agent Readiness Scanner

    Free URL scanner that scores your site's current agent readiness and surfaces exactly what's missing across identity, readability, and commerce layers.


Use Cases

  • Travel & Hospitality : Hotels and accommodation providers can be discovered, compared, and booked directly by AI agents — bypassing OTA middlemen and capturing demand at the source.
  • Publishing & News Media : Publishers can expose paywalled articles and research to AI agents for pay-per-article transactions, adapting to agent-driven reader behavior shifts.
  • SaaS & Developer Tools : Software platforms can expose API access and usage-based billing plans that agents can sign up for and pay autonomously.
  • E-commerce : Online stores can enable AI agents to discover, select, and complete purchases directly on their own storefronts without marketplace intermediaries.
  • Media & Creator Economy : Streaming platforms and individual creators can offer subscriptions and content that agents can discover, choose, and pay for on their behalf.
